Rosstat: Russian stainless steel production increases in Nov y-o-y

According to statistics from the Russian Federal State Statistics Service (Rosstat), Russian stainless steel production totaled around 16,200 tons in November, increasing by 22.1% from the same month a year ago and also up by 5.8% compared to the previous month.

In the first 11 months of this year, Russian stainless steel output reached roughly 137,000 tons, a year-on-year hike of 1.1%.

Russia’s stainless steel demand is steady because the main consumers are industries in nuclear energy and power engineering, shipbuilding, defense industry, and oil and gas complex, all of which have sufficient funds and long-term plans.
